Author Description
Professor William Arthur Roger Mullin is a former Scottish National Party (SNP) politician. He was the Member of Parliament (MP) for Kirkcaldy and Cowdenbeath from May 2015, until being defeated at the 2017 snap general election.
Mullin graduated from the University of Edinburgh with a M.A. Honours degree in Sociology in 1977. He was a Member of the Institute of Personnel and Development and also holds a Higher National Certificate in Electrical and Electronic Engineering.
He is an Honorary Professor at the University of Stirling, and lectured postgraduates on Applied Decision Theory, The Political Environment, and Organisation Change. He wrote a monthly column in
The Times Educational Supplement Scotland
. He is now a Founding Director of Momentous Change Ltd.
Mullen is an active campaigner against corruption in the finance system and is an ambassador for Transparency Task Force in the UK. He is also a director of the humanitarian organisation REVIVE Campaign that seeks to provide a voice to the most innocent victims of conflict across the globe.
